Paul McCartney's journey as a songwriter and musician has been nothing short of legendary. From his early days with the Beatles to his solo career with Wings, McCartney has continuously pushed the boundaries of music and creativity. In the documentary "Get Back," we see McCartney's meticulous approach to songwriting and his relentless pursuit of perfection. After the Beatles disbanded, McCartney and his wife Linda retreated to a Scottish sheep farm to embark on a new chapter in their lives.

The move to Scotland was a deliberate choice to escape the chaos of London and start afresh. McCartney found solace in the isolation of the Scottish countryside, where he could focus on creating new music. With Linda by his side, McCartney embraced a new sense of freedom and independence, leading to the formation of Wings and a string of successful albums. Despite facing challenges and controversies along the way, McCartney's passion for music never wavered.

The story of Wings is a testament to McCartney's resilience and creativity. The band's iconic album "Band on the Run" captured the spirit of freedom and rebellion that defined the era. McCartney's ability to connect with audiences through his music, whether through social protest or unity, showcases the power of music as a universal language. As Wings toured the world, their music resonated with fans from all walks of life, transcending cultural and political boundaries.
